Output 70f548d484923c3f1ad3a44f42b1a03893e6d3685ed8746eea859668122d9323:1

value
3025866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89cbb2d05e012edeb58b67575b8747177c44e704 OP_EQUAL
address
3EFcX3Voumt9d2uFv61tKA3nm2ZadG1x38
transaction
70f548d484923c3f1ad3a44f42b1a03893e6d3685ed8746eea859668122d9323
confirmations
315827
spent
true